transgenic cotton strains, cry1f and cry1ac, and their event-specific identification. The present invention relates to plant breeding and the protection of plants against insects. More specifically, this invention includes unusual cotton plant transformation events comprising one or more polynucleotide sequences, as described herein, inserted within a specific site or sites within the genome of a cotton cell. in highly preferred embodiments, said polynucleotide sequences encode the "combined" lepidopteran, cry1f and cry1ac insect inhibitory proteins. however, the subject invention includes plants that have a single cry1f or cry1ac event as described herein. Additionally, the invention relates to cotton plants derived from this transformation event and assays to detect the presence of the event in a sample. More specifically, the present invention provides DNA assays and related assays for detecting the presence of certain insect resistance events in cotton. The assays are based on the DNA sequences of recombinant constructs inserted into the algadão genome and the genomic sequences that flank the insertion sites. These sequences are unique. Based on these insertion and boundary sequences, specific event initiators were generated. pcr analysis demonstrated that these cotton strains can be identified in different cotton genotypes by analyzing the pcr amplicons generated with these event-specific primer sets. therefore, these procedures and other related procedures may be used to uniquely identify these cotton strains. Kits and conditions useful for conducting the tests are also provided. These materials and methods can also be used to aid grafting programs in order to develop traces on cotton.
